Detailed Description

The RenderTargetSelectGroup is used in combination with the FrameBufferTextureGenerator to select which color textures to render into.

The RenderTargetSelectGroup must always be a child of a FrameBufferTextureGenerator. If used outside a FrameBufferTextureGenerator the result is undefined.

The renderTargets field contains the indices of the color textures of the parent FrameBufferTextureGenerator you want to render the children into. If an index provided is outside the range of the parent FrameBufferTextureGenerator color textures the result is undefined.

Member Data Documentation

◆ renderTargets

H3DUniquePtr< MFInt32 > H3D::RenderTargetSelectGroup::renderTargets

The renderTargets field contains the indices of the color textures of the parent FrameBufferTextureGenerator you want to render the children into.

If an index provided is outside the range of the parent FrameBufferTextureGenerator color textures the result is undefined.

Access type: inputOutput Default value: []
